Participants with early-onset obesity in the SURMOUNT clinical trials show a mixed profile of metabolic health at baseline despite a relatively young biological age. They exhibit concerning features, such as higher waist circumference and fasting insulin, as well as favourable features, including lower systolic blood pressure (SBP) and HbA1c compared with the late-onset group.

Women treated for early invasive breast cancer have a slightly higher risk of a second primary cancer than those in the general population, reveals a study. Such risk is greater among younger women.
